Analysis

Romania recorded 29.1% for coverage in 5th quintile (richest) (%) - unconditional cash transfers in 2021.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 12.9% on the previous year and up 3.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, coverage in 5th quintile (richest) (%) - unconditional cash transfers in Romania peaked at 31.4%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 25.7%, in 2020.

Romania ranks 10th of 27 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Coverage in 5th quintile (richest) (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ers in Romania, year by year

Annual values for Coverage in 5th quintile (richest) (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ers -rural in Romania, 2008 to 2021.
Year Value Change
2008 29.2%
2011 28.1% -3.5%
2012 30.2% +7.4%
2016 28.1% -7.0%
2019 31.4% +11.9%
2020 25.7% -18.1%
2021 29.1% +12.9%
